Description

NY 03 NE CROSSCANONBY THE GREEN Birkby

11/51 The Retreat

II

House. Early C19. Painted stucco walls with angle pilasters and stone parapet. Graduated greenslate roof with rendered chimney stacks. 2 storeys, 5 bays with lower 2-storey, 3-bay right extension. Canted 2-storey central bay has panelled double doors under stone panels and tall 2-light windows in stone surrounds. Sash windows in chamfered painted surrounds under hoodmoulds. Extension has linenfold panelled door with overlight. C20 garage door to right. Sash windows with glazing bars in painted stone surrounds.
